Transaction 103438b38b7b372379f37a67bab960bc499a909c548223ac0ddb1d2d20aadd98

1 Input
2 Outputs
  • 103438b38b7b372379f37a67bab960bc499a909c548223ac0ddb1d2d20aadd98:0
  • value  251010
    address  18DU3qAC1sALwZ9yyWmmRzyfM2kesVQDyj
  • 103438b38b7b372379f37a67bab960bc499a909c548223ac0ddb1d2d20aadd98:1
  • value  2805000
    address  38LiZhZL9gMzobhgrzjVWHYcCgERPGMkkZ